Exclude Code Sections from Code Coverage Using the ExcludeFromCodeCoverage Attribute
يحتوي كل نوع بيانات SQL افتراضي منشئ البيانات مقترن به. منشئ افتراضي هو المعينة تلقائياً على أعمدة التي لها نوع بيانات SQL معين عند إنشاء على خطة إنشاء بيانات .
ملاحظة
منشئ افتراضي هو تلقائياً تجاوز بعض قيود العمود. على سبيل المثال، إذا كان عمود تعريف وعمود المفتاح خارجي أعمدة عددا صحيحاً، فإنها استخدم مولدات بيانات القيمة المحسوبة SQL "و" المفتاح خارجي، لا مولد عدد صحيح الافتراضي.
يمكنك تغيير منشئ بيانات بطريقتين:
يمكنك تغيير منشئ البيانات المعين لعمود معين في خطة إنشاء بيانات محددة. يؤثر هذا تغيير فقط على بيانات إنشاء خطة إجراء تغيير. لمزيد من المعلومات، راجع قم بتحديد تفاصيل لإنشاء بيانات للعمود.
يمكنك تغيير منشئ بيانات هو الوضع الافتراضي لنوع بيانات SQL. يؤثر هذا تغيير على الجميع بيانات جديدة إنشاء الخطط التي تقوم بإنشائها بعد إجراء تغيير. ويؤثر أيضا على أي أعمدة التي قمت بإضافتها إلى خطط توليد بيانات موجود. لمزيد من المعلومات، راجع كيفية القيام بما يلي: تغيير منشئ افتراضي للعمود نوع.
الافتراضي بيانات مولدات
تصف المقاطع التالية الافتراضي مولدات المقترنة مع أنواع بيانات SQL. إلى مشاهدة نفس المعلومات في جدول مفرد، راجع موقع ويب سريع إنشاء تشكيل جانبي مع VSPerfASPNETCmd.
أرقام الدقيقة
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
بت |
نعم |
نعم |
بت |
tinyint |
نعم |
نعم |
tinyint |
smallint |
نعم |
نعم |
smallint |
عدد صحيح |
نعم |
نعم |
Integer (عدد صحيح) |
عدد صحيح كبير |
نعم |
نعم |
عدد صحيح كبير |
عشري |
نعم |
نعم |
عشري |
عددي |
نعم |
نعم |
عشري |
smallmoney |
نعم |
نعم |
المال |
money |
نعم |
نعم |
المال |
أرقام تقريبية
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
حر |
نعم |
نعم |
Float (عائم) |
حقيقي |
نعم |
نعم |
real |
التاريخ والوقت
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
smalldatetime |
نعم |
نعم |
التاريخ والوقت |
datetime |
نعم |
نعم |
التاريخ والوقت |
حرف سلاسل
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
حرف |
نعم |
نعم |
سلسة نصية |
varchar |
نعم |
نعم |
سلسة نصية |
varchar(أقصى) |
نعم |
نعم |
سلسة نصية |
نص |
نعم |
نعم |
سلسة نصية |
سلاسل الأحرف Unicode
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
nchar |
نعم |
نعم |
سلسة نصية |
nvarchar |
نعم |
نعم |
سلسة نصية |
nvarchar(أقصى) |
نعم |
نعم |
سلسة نصية |
ntext |
نعم |
نعم |
سلسة نصية |
سلاسل ثنائي
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
ثنائي |
نعم |
نعم |
Binary |
varbinary |
نعم |
نعم |
Binary |
varbinary(أقصى) |
نعم |
نعم |
Binary |
صورة |
نعم |
نعم |
الصورة |
أنواع بيانات غير ذلك
نوع بيانات SQL |
SQL 2008 |
SQL 2005 |
الافتراضي منشئ بيانات |
---|---|---|---|
sql_variant |
نعم |
نعم |
Integer (عدد صحيح) |
sysname |
نعم |
نعم |
سلسة نصية |
timestamp |
نعم |
نعم |
لا يوجد منشئ بيانات الافتراضية. Th هو بيانات هو حسابه بواسطة SQL الخادم عند ذلك هو إدراجها. |
uniqueidentifier |
نعم |
نعم |
Guid |
SQL معرّفة بواسطة مستخدم أنواع |
نعم |
نعم |
تحديد بواسطة القاعدة نوع من المعرفة من قبل مستخدم نوع. |
CLR.NET المعرفة من قبل مستخدم أنواع |
نعم |
نعم |
سلسة نصية |
xml |
نعم |
نعم |
سلسة نصية |
راجع أيضًا:
المبادئ
إنشاء اختبار البيانات لقواعد بيانات باستخدام مولدات البيانات